2 Venues for private hire

Queen Anne Building

Capacity: 120 people (dinner), 170 people (reception)

This majestic banqueting venue in Crown Square is available to hire year-round for evening events. Drinks and canapés are served in the adjacent indoor courtyard. A private viewing of the Honours of Scotland is included for evening hires.

Jacobite Room

Capacity: 100 people (dinner), 190 people (reception – with adjoining Redcoat Room), theatre 150 people

Magnificent high ceilings and superb views of the Edinburgh skyline are highlights of this flexible and modern space within an 18th-century building. Guests can enjoy pre-dinner drinks in the adjoining Redcoat Room, or the two rooms can be combined for a buffet or reception for up to 200 people. Private viewings of the Honours of Scotland and are possible.

Gatehouse Suite

Capacity: 22 people (dinner), 35 people (reception – using both rooms), 28 people (theatre)

Meetings and seminars can be held in the intimate setting of these 19th-century rooms at the castle entrance. Available to hire day and evening, this venue is a popular choice for small dinners, receptions and other special events. The two adjoining rooms can be used to host up to 40 people for a reception. Access to a private terrace with breathtaking views of Edinburgh can be arranged.

Scottish banquet

A traditional piper’s welcome awaits your guests upon arrival at the drawbridge. They will then follow the sound of the pipes into the castle to sample more of Scotland’s world-famous hospitality.

The Scottish banquet package includes:

  • exclusive hire of dining area
  • flaming torches on arrival
  • drinks and canapés reception
  • four-course Scottish-themed dinner
  • private viewing of the Honours of Scotland
  • entertainment – piper, clarsach player, pipe band
  • Scottish-themed table décor and chair covers, coloured table linen, tartan runners
  • floral centrepieces
  • services of an on-site events manager

A spectacular finale will draw the evening to a close. The pipe band will perform a medley of traditional Scottish music before leading guests from the castle.

Military Tattoo hospitality

Each year, the Royal Edinburgh Military Tattoo showcases the talents of musicians and performers from around the globe. Its incredible setting is the floodlit Castle Esplanade, high above the skyline of Scotland’s capital.

Music, ceremony, entertainment and theatre combine to create a stunning spectacle. Going behind the scenes will make your guests’ Tattoo experience truly unforgettable – add exceptional hospitality and an enticing menu served in Edinburgh Castle to your evening.
